DISCIPLEHow do you create followers?

Be A Mentor Generator

DISCIPLEThe Process is pretty simple

1. The Mentor WORKS while the Mentee WATCH.

2. The Mentor and the Mentee WORKS TOGETHER.

3. The Mentor WATCH while the Mentee WORKS.

4. The Mentee Mentor.

RESEARCH

RESEARCHDon't get locked into your hear and now

or the ‘this is what work in my days’ mentality. A seed that does not grow is dried up. Spend quality time in personal development. If you want to be effective you must have the ability to be a lifelong

learner.

RESEARCH.A healthy youth ministry is led by someone who invest in their own

personal development. They read books & blogs, interact with others, acquire new resources, and learn new ways of

practicing ministry.

RESEARCHStudy the culture of the youths, (interest, lifestyle, dress, talks, etc.) and know how

NETWORKConnect with other people in the

trenches. Share information, ideas or programs. Don't be a lone ranger. Trust me on this, connect with other youth

workers and connect regularly to share ideas and pray for each other. It will is far better than trying to do it all by yourself.
